One person has died and another is missing after six workers were swept into the Yangtze river while watching a ship-launch near Wuhu, Anhui province. The ship company and the local maritime affairs department are still searching for the remaining missing worker.
The Wuhu Xinlian Shipbuilding Company launched its latest vessel on Monday morning. But as the huge ship rushed into the water, a strong back wave swept six workers of the company into the river.
Hearing screams from the river bank, nearby fishing boats moved to rescue the workers.
The ship company has initiated an emergency rescue plan and the local maritime affairs department has also mobilized ships to join the effort. One body has been recovered. The local authority said they have enlarged the search area in a bid to find the missing person.
The four rescued workers are now in a stable condition. A witness said the six were standing too close to the water.
